Nubuck turns the visible grain side of leather into a tactile surface. Controlled sanding raises a fine nap, softens reflected light and creates depth that distinguishes nubuck from smoother grain leathers. The effect can make footwear, bags and interiors feel premium, but it also makes surface consistency central to the product promise.

That premium impression hides a system problem. Hide quality, sanding and dyeing shape the nap and color, while the end use determines exposure to rubbing, water, oils and cleaning. A beautiful swatch can therefore underperform on a boot toe, handbag corner or high-contact interior panel.

Market comparison is also complicated. Direct nubuck statistics are narrower than general leather data, while many published markets include nubuck inside broader categories. Footwear and leather-goods figures show downstream scale but should not be treated as nubuck-only revenue.

This report follows nubuck from its direct market signals and material position through footwear, leather goods, automotive interiors, regional demand, country-level opportunity, synthetic competition, maintenance and lifecycle performance. The objective is to identify where nubuck creates measurable value and where its premium appearance depends on stronger disclosure, application matching and long-term care.

Why Nubuck Leather Requires a System-Based Benchmark

Nubuck is often judged first by touch, yet softness alone does not determine finished-product performance. Grain structure, sanding consistency, color penetration, protective treatment and use environment shape what the customer experiences after the initial impression.

Surface failures usually reveal a weak layer rather than a universal material flaw. Patchy reflection can indicate uneven nap; darkened contact areas can reflect oils; flattened zones can result from friction. Edge damage or toe wear shows whether the finish was engineered for the application.

No single label should dominate judgment. Genuine leather does not automatically indicate premium nubuck; a high price does not prove finish consistency; and a large market forecast does not establish product durability. Likewise, a synthetic nubuck-like material can outperform natural nubuck on color repeatability or cleaning ease without reproducing the same material identity or aging pattern.

A complete benchmark therefore separates surface quality, leather integrity, durability, color, application fit, care, commercial proof and disclosure before combining them. This system view explains why the same nubuck can be compelling on one product and impractical on another without treating either outcome as a verdict on the entire category.

Direct Nubuck Market Signals

Direct nubuck statistics are narrower than the surrounding leather market, which makes each specific measurement more valuable. In the examined real-leather Chelsea-boot market, nubuck accounts for approximately $705 million in 2025. That places the material at 21.66% of the market, behind full-grain leather at 44.55% and suede at 33.79%.

The relationship is useful because Chelsea boots are a visible material-led product. The leather surface is not hidden inside the construction; it forms a large share of what the buyer sees and touches. Nubuck can therefore compete through color depth, matte appearance and tactile identity even when it does not lead the category by volume.

Engineered-material data provide a second direct indicator. Microfiber nubuck reaches about $305.03 million and 9.92% of the examined third-generation artificial-leather market in 2025. This is much smaller than the microfiber grain and suede categories, yet it demonstrates a deliberate commercial demand for a nubuck-like surface rather than an incidental texture variation.

Together, the natural and microfiber figures suggest that nubuck is best understood as a specialized surface proposition. It is large enough to support dedicated products and material development, but selective enough that brands must connect the finish to a clear application, customer and care expectation.

Nubuck vs Full-Grain vs Suede Market Position

Material comparison becomes more useful when it separates role from rank. Full-grain leather leads the examined Chelsea-boot market at approximately $1.45 billion, or 44.55%. Suede follows at about $1.10 billion and 33.79%, while nubuck contributes roughly $705 million and 21.66%. The three categories therefore divide a common product market without serving identical aesthetic or performance expectations.

Full-grain positioning is usually built around visible grain, classic leather identity and a durable surface that develops wear character. Suede emphasizes a softer fibrous face and a distinctly casual or tactile appearance. Nubuck uses the grain side but changes the optical and tactile effect through sanding, producing a fine nap that can appear more refined than a rougher suede surface while retaining a different structural identity.

The commercial implication is that share should not be interpreted as a quality ranking. A smaller nubuck share may reflect narrower style use, higher maintenance expectations, different seasonality or selective premium placement. Those constraints can reduce volume while strengthening differentiation in products where the surface itself is part of the design language.

For brands, the useful question is not whether nubuck can replace every grain or suede application. It is whether its tactile depth, color behavior and premium matte finish create enough value in the intended product to justify the additional care and presentation requirements.

Microfiber Nubuck and Synthetic Competition

Third-generation artificial leather shows how the nubuck concept has moved beyond natural hide. The total market in the examined series is approximately $3.075 billion in 2025, with three major surface groups. Microfiber grain leather contributes about $1.51 billion, microfiber suede about $1.26 billion, and microfiber nubuck $305.03 million.

Share data sharpen the contrast. Grain represents 49.09%, suede 40.99% and nubuck 9.92%. The nubuck segment is therefore clearly smaller, yet a nearly ten-percent position in a multi-billion-dollar engineered-material market is commercially meaningful. It indicates that manufacturers continue to value a controlled matte nap distinct from both smooth grain and suede-like surfaces.

The surrounding artificial-leather market is also expanding. The same dataset moves from about $2.15 billion in 2020 to $3.075 billion in 2025 and projects approximately $5.07 billion by 2032. Automotive interiors account for about $1.14 billion of 2025 demand, footwear about $996.3 million, furniture and upholstery about $530.97 million, luggage and bags around $292.3 million, and apparel and other uses about $113.9 million.

Synthetic competition matters because it changes the benchmark. Natural nubuck competes on authenticity, leather character and aging, while microfiber alternatives can compete on uniformity, repeatable color, scalable production and different maintenance economics. The buyer may value either system depending on the product objective.

Footwear as the Core Nubuck Demand Engine

Footwear is the clearest large-scale demand environment for nubuck. One global leather-footwear series rises from $150.7 billion in 2024 to $229.2 billion by 2033; another moves from $165.23 billion in 2025 to $274.80 billion by 2032. The totals differ by scope but both show substantial growth.

The direct Chelsea-boot data connect that broader scale back to nubuck. Within the examined real-leather Chelsea-boot market, nubuck holds 21.66% and approximately $705 million of value. That share is large enough to show established product acceptance while still leaving full-grain and suede ahead in the same market.

Footwear suits nubuck because the material can alter the entire visual character of a shoe. A matte nap can soften a structured silhouette, create tonal depth in darker colors and support premium casual styling. At the same time, footwear is an unforgiving use case: toe flexing, contact with ground moisture, abrasion, brushing, salt, dust and repeated bending can all change the surface faster than on lower-contact accessories.

This tension makes footwear a strong benchmark category. A successful nubuck shoe has to deliver more than showroom softness. It must preserve a coherent surface through realistic wear and provide care instructions that help the buyer recover nap and color after ordinary use. The commercial size of footwear therefore magnifies both the opportunity and the importance of lifecycle performance.

Footwear Distribution and Consumer Architecture

Leather footwear remains strongly influenced by physical retail. Offline channels account for approximately 73.4% of global leather-footwear revenue in the examined 2024 data, and the offline market is valued at about $110.60 billion. It is projected to reach roughly $149.83 billion by 2033, showing that store-based purchasing remains commercially important even as digital discovery expands.

The channel structure matters for nubuck because touch is part of the product experience. In a store, the customer can see the nap shift under changing light, compare shade depth and assess softness directly. Online, those cues have to be recreated through close-up images, movement video, material descriptions and accurate color photography. A generic product image can understate or misrepresent the very feature that justifies a nubuck premium.

Consumer segmentation adds another layer. Male buyers represent approximately 54.1% of leather-footwear revenue in the cited 2024 view, while the female leather-footwear segment is projected to grow at about 5.4% CAGR. Asia Pacific accounts for roughly 53.9% of global leather-footwear revenue, making the region particularly important to production, retail and product development.

The strongest strategy therefore combines channel and product design. Nubuck styles intended for high-touch physical retail can emphasize tactile differentiation, while digitally led products require more disciplined visual proof and clearer care communication.

Leather Goods Market Growth

Leather goods create a second major demand platform, but market estimates vary significantly by scope. One series places the global market at $282.1 billion in 2025 and $538.2 billion by 2033, while another estimates $448.2 billion in 2025 and $644.63 billion by 2031. A third series reports $428.6 billion in 2025 and $648.1 billion by 2034, and another starts at $431.09 billion in 2025 before reaching $618.07 billion in 2030.

The correct response to these differences is not to average them. Each series can include different product boundaries, material definitions, distribution assumptions and forecast windows. Used separately, they still tell a consistent strategic story: leather goods represent a large, expanding commercial environment in which material choice can materially affect product identity.

For nubuck, bags and accessories create a different value equation from footwear. The material can occupy large uninterrupted panels, making color and nap easy to see. Hand contact can produce localized darkening, while corners and straps face friction. A handbag may avoid the repeated flexing of a shoe but encounter cosmetics, oils, rain, clothing transfer and storage pressure instead.

Travel products raise the performance requirement further because they combine frequent handling with abrasion and unpredictable environments. The nubuck-inclusive leather travel-bag market grows from about $3.52 billion in 2025 to $6.24 billion by 2033, reinforcing the need to connect tactile appeal with protection and maintenance.

Automotive Bovine Leather Market

The global automotive bovine leather market is estimated at $1.21 billion in 2025 and projected to reach about $2.01 billion by 2035 at roughly 5.2% CAGR. Nubuck appears as an explicit material type within the category.

Automotive use can expose leather to thousands of contact cycles, prolonged pressure, temperature change and repeated cleaning. Large adjacent panels also make color and nap differences more visible.

Nubuck can support premium positioning at controlled touchpoints or as a contrast to smoother leather, but it needs clear specifications for color, abrasion, cleaning and lot consistency.

Market growth therefore creates opportunity without lowering the technical bar. Automotive buyers are not simply purchasing softness; they are purchasing a reproducible interior material system.

Nubuck in Travel Bags and Interior Applications

Travel bags and interiors reveal how the same surface can face very different stress patterns. The nubuck-inclusive leather travel-bag market is valued at approximately $3.52 billion in 2025 and projected to reach about $6.24 billion by 2033, a reported 7.42% CAGR. The category benefits from premium-material storytelling but exposes surfaces to handling, abrasion, stacking and unpredictable weather.

A separate leather-floor market that includes nubuck starts at around $4.5 billion in 2025 and reaches approximately $9.8 billion by 2034, with about 7.6% CAGR. This is a very different use environment, but it demonstrates that textured leather surfaces can participate in architectural and interior categories where visual depth and tactile interest are valuable.

The contrast clarifies application fit. Travel products need edge protection, stain management and recoverable surface appearance after movement. Interior products need consistent panels, controlled fading and maintenance systems suited to longer service life. A finish that performs adequately on an occasional-use item may require different protection when exposed to continuous contact.

For manufacturers, the lesson is to define premium performance by the product's actual stress profile. Nubuck should not be specified only because a swatch feels luxurious; it should be selected because the entire finish system can sustain the expected use.

Country-Level Leather Footwear Demand

Country-level footwear data show where nubuck can participate in large leather-consumption markets. China is the largest country in the comparison, moving from approximately $43.32 billion in 2024 to $66.41 billion by 2033. India follows at about $22.05 billion in 2025 and $32.80 billion by 2033, while the United States grows from $17.95 billion to $25.04 billion.

European markets remain smaller but commercially important. Italy rises from approximately $9.42 billion to $13.15 billion, Germany from $8.40 billion to $10.23 billion, and the United Kingdom from $5.59 billion to $6.75 billion. Japan moves from around $6.68 billion to $10.46 billion, giving it a faster growth profile than several mature European markets.

Share data add perspective. India holds approximately 13.6% of the global leather-footwear market in the cited 2025 view, the United States 11.1%, Italy 5.8%, Germany 5.2% and Japan 4.1%. These positions show why scale and growth should remain separate: a country can be large today without being the fastest-expanding market.

For nubuck, country selection should also consider product culture. Boot demand, premium sneaker acceptance, outdoor styling, fashion cycles and in-store material experience can all influence how a tactile leather performs commercially. The strongest opportunity is therefore not necessarily the country with the largest total leather-footwear value.

Nubuck Care, Cleaning and Lifecycle Demand

Nubuck's value continues after sale because its nap can darken from oils, flatten under friction, collect dust and show water marks more readily than heavily coated smooth leather. Maintenance is therefore part of the product architecture.

Care demand can move differently from finished-goods demand. In Pakistan, a leather-conditioner market that includes nubuck records a 12.04% import decline from 2023 to 2024 and a -9.1% CAGR across 20202024. These figures describe the care channel, not nubuck use itself.

Lifecycle care starts with prevention. Brushing can restore light compression, suitable protection can reduce water and staining damage, and cleaning should focus on controlled surface recovery. Abrasive treatment can permanently alter nap height and color even when the leather remains structurally intact.

For brands, lifecycle value should be measured by appearance retention and recoverability. A surface that looks premium only before the first month of real use creates weaker value than one that can be maintained through clear, repeatable care.

Building the Nubuck Leather Benchmark Index

The Nubuck Leather Benchmark Index uses eight weighted pillars. Surface quality and nap consistency receive 17%, leather integrity and construction 16%, durability and wear resistance 15%, and color and finish consistency 13%.

Application suitability and care/lifecycle performance each receive 11%, commercial value and market proof 9%, and disclosure and material transparency 8%. The weights total 100% and prevent one premium cue from determining the score.

Scores from 0 to 39 indicate weak or poorly verified performance, 40 to 59 commercial basic, 60 to 74 competitive developing, 75 to 89 professional premium and 90 to 100 exceptional lifecycle performance. Material and application sub-scores should remain visible because the same nubuck may be excellent for a fashion accessory yet inappropriate for a high-abrasion use.

The index also creates a disclosure rule. Missing leather identity, finish description, care instructions or application limits should reduce confidence because the product cannot be evaluated consistently. Premium positioning is strongest when the surface claim is backed by measurable construction and lifecycle evidence.

Nubuck Leather Market Challenges

The first market challenge is terminology. Nubuck, suede, brushed leather, split leather and synthetic nubuck-look materials can appear close in product photography even though their structures and maintenance profiles differ. When sellers use loose labels, customers may buy one material while expecting the behavior of another.

The second challenge is surface sensitivity. Nubuck's fine nap creates depth because fibers reflect light differently as they move, but the same surface can show contact patterns, moisture and cleaning history. Product pages that present only pristine studio photography understate the lifecycle dimension of the finish.

The third challenge is market measurement. Direct nubuck figures are limited, so broad leather statistics are often used without clear qualification. That can make a large leather-footwear or leather-goods forecast appear to be a nubuck-only market number. Strong reporting separates direct nubuck data, nubuck-inclusive categories and downstream demand proxies.

The fourth challenge is synthetic competition. Microfiber nubuck is already a $305.03 million segment in the examined 2025 artificial-leather market. Alternative materials can compete on repeatable appearance, cost and consistency, increasing pressure on natural nubuck to justify its premium through material identity, craftsmanship and lifecycle value.

90-Day Nubuck Leather Benchmark Plan

Days 1–30: Material and product audit

Record product category, declared leather type, finish description, color, thickness where available, price, care instructions and intended use. Photograph the material under consistent front, side and grazing light so nap direction and color depth can be compared. Inspect corners, folds, seams and high-contact zones before wear begins.

Days 31–60: Normalized performance testing

Track surface change during realistic use. Measure brushing recovery, visible darkening, stain sensitivity, water response, abrasion, color transfer and cleaning effort. Keep exposure consistent across test pieces so one product is not penalized because it experienced more severe conditions. For footwear, separate toe flex and upper wear; for bags, separate corners, handles and body panels.

Days 61–90: Lifecycle scoring

Repeat normal wear, cleaning and storage cycles. Score nap retention, color consistency, stain recovery, structural condition, maintenance time and visual aging. Record whether the surface returns to an acceptable appearance after care rather than focusing only on the amount of change during use.

The final benchmark should identify which products maintain a convincing surface without requiring unrealistic maintenance. Results can then support clearer care instructions, application-specific product claims and stronger material selection.

Metrics Nubuck Brands and Retailers Should Track

Product measurement should begin with material identity and surface consistency. Track leather type, finish, declared thickness, measured color, nap uniformity, lot-to-lot variation, abrasion response and brushing recovery. Finished-product testing should add edge wear, crease behavior, contact darkening and any visible difference between panels.

Consumer measurement should include return rate, material-description complaints, color mismatch, staining complaints, cleaning difficulty, repeat purchase and recommendation intent. Reviews that describe how nubuck looks after weeks or months of use are more valuable than first-day comments because they reveal lifecycle performance.

Commercial measurement should connect price, margin, conversion, markdowns, returns and product mix while separating natural nubuck from synthetic nubuck-look products. Country and channel should remain visible because online and offline customers experience the surface differently before purchase.

Lifecycle measurement should capture cleaning frequency, restoration success, appearance retention, cost per successful use and replacement timing. Revenue describes popularity; repeatable surface recovery reveals whether the premium promise survives ownership.

The Nubuck Leather Report FAQ

What is nubuck leather?

Nubuck is leather whose grain side is lightly sanded or buffed to create a fine, velvet-like nap. The treatment changes surface reflection and hand feel while retaining a different structure from typical suede.

Is nubuck the same as suede?

No. Both have a nap, but nubuck is associated with the grain side while suede is generally produced from the flesh side or split structure, creating different surface character and positioning.

How large is the nubuck leather market?

Direct figures are narrower than broad leather-market estimates. In one real-leather Chelsea-boot market, nubuck represents about $705 million and 21.66% in 2025. In third-generation artificial leather, microfiber nubuck represents approximately $305.03 million and 9.92%. Broader nubuck-inclusive markets are much larger but should not be described as nubuck-only revenue.

Where is nubuck leather most commonly used?

The largest relevant demand environments include footwear, bags and leather goods, automotive interiors and selected interior products. Footwear is especially important because the global leather-footwear market reaches approximately $150.7 billion in 2024 in one major series and grows toward $229.2 billion by 2033.

Is nubuck more expensive than suede?

There is no universal rule. Price depends on hide quality, finishing, construction, brand, country and application, so product-level comparison should include material quality and lifecycle performance.

How important is footwear to nubuck demand?

Very. Asia Pacific holds about 53.9% of leather-footwear revenue, offline channels 73.4%, and the examined Chelsea-boot market gives nubuck a direct 21.66% material share.

Is synthetic nubuck becoming more important?

Engineered nubuck-like materials are commercially significant. Microfiber nubuck is valued at about $305.03 million in the examined 2025 market, while the wider third-generation artificial-leather category grows from around $3.075 billion in 2025 toward $5.07 billion by 2032.

Which countries offer the strongest nubuck opportunities?

China, the United States, India, Italy, Germany, Japan and the United Kingdom all provide substantial footwear or leather-goods demand. The best opportunity depends on the intended product, material mix, price position, channel and growth rate rather than one universal country ranking.
